internal List <Proizvod.Proizvod> getAllProducts() { List <Proizvod.Proizvod> listOfProducts = new List <Proizvod.Proizvod>(); string query = "SELECT * FROM lijek_info_pogled"; if (this.OpenConnection() == true) { MySqlCommand cmd = new MySqlCommand(query, connection); MySqlDataReader data = cmd.ExecuteReader(); Proizvod.Proizvod proizvod; if (data.HasRows) { while (data.Read()) { proizvod = new Proizvod.Proizvod(data.GetString(0), data.GetString(1), data.GetString(2), data.GetDouble(3), data.GetDateTime(4).ToShortDateString(), data.GetInt32(5), data.GetString(6), data.GetString(7), data.GetString(8)); listOfProducts.Add(proizvod); } } data.Close(); this.CloseConnection(); } foreach (Proizvod.Proizvod p in listOfProducts) { Console.WriteLine(p.ToString()); } return(listOfProducts); }
internal bool dodajLijekUBazu(Proizvod.Proizvod p) { string query = "insert into proizvod values ('" + p.SifraPr + "','" + p.Naziv + "','" + p.Proizvodjac + "','" + p.Cijena + "','" + p.RokUpotrebe + "','" + p.Kolicina + "')"; string query2 = "insert into lijek values ('" + p.SifraPr + "','" + p.AtcSifra + "','" + p.Oblik + "','" + p.Lista + "')"; if (this.OpenConnection() == true) { try { MySqlCommand cmd = new MySqlCommand(query, connection); MySqlDataReader data = cmd.ExecuteReader(); data.Close(); cmd = new MySqlCommand(query2, connection); data = cmd.ExecuteReader(); data.Close(); this.CloseConnection(); } catch (Exception s) { return(false); } } return(true); }
internal List <Proizvod.Proizvod> getAllDrugs() { List <Proizvod.Proizvod> listOfProducts = new List <Proizvod.Proizvod>(); string query = "SELECT SifraProizvoda, Naziv FROM proizvod"; if (this.OpenConnection() == true) { MySqlCommand cmd = new MySqlCommand(query, connection); MySqlDataReader data = cmd.ExecuteReader(); Proizvod.Proizvod proizvod; if (data.HasRows) { while (data.Read()) { proizvod = new Proizvod.Proizvod(data.GetString(0), data.GetString(1)); listOfProducts.Add(proizvod); } } data.Close(); this.CloseConnection(); } return(listOfProducts); }
public Racun_stavka(Proizvod.Proizvod p, int kolicina, double ukupno) { this.proizvod = p; this.kolicina = kolicina; this.ukupno = ukupno; }